MANA Goal - Tū whakamihia - Respecting each other


Waiho i te toipoto, kaua i te toiroa - Let us keep close together, not wide apart


We will achieve this by:

  • Respecting each others’ personal boundaries, when someone says no, or stop, then we stop

  • Thank others for helping us

  • Help others whenever we can

  • Know that not everyone thinks the way we do and that is ok

  • Respecting others and the way they are feeling

  • Using kind words that make people feel great - kōrero pai

  • We will listen to the speaker by watching them, keeping quiet and taking in what they are saying

  • Open doors for staff who need help

  • Keep our hands and feet to ourselves

  • Respect other people’s property by keeping it clean and tidy

  • Follow instructions the first time

  • Do your job once and do it properly



Success Indicator:

  • We will better know ourselves and what we can do to help ourselves and others

  • Our class will be calmer and more controlled helping us to learn better

  • We will feel respected and cared for when people speak to us using kind words

  • We can continue to improve and develop our reputation in a positive way

  • When you help someone, you will feel proud of yourself and they will feel proud of you

  • We will be thanked for our thoughtfulness

  • We will feel safe and happy in our personal space

  • We will know what to do for our learning
